Overview

KELSO ELEM. is a public elementary serving grades -1–8 in BENTON, Missouri. The school enrolls 210 students. It is part of the KELSO C-7 district.

Equity & Title I

In the United States, Free/Reduced Lunch (FRL) eligibility is the primary federal proxy for student poverty. Schools with 40% or more FRL-eligible students typically qualify for Title I school-wide programs.
